The Phoenix Suns are opening their season tonight against the Sacramento Kings. Tip-off is at Mortgage Matchup Center, formerly PHX Arena, at 7 p.m.
Jalen Green will miss the Suns’ season opener against the Kings while recovering from a hamstring injury. The Suns have gone from championship contenders to having no expectations. They moved Kevin Durant in the summer to acquire Jalen Green. Green will miss the team’s season opener against the Kings with a hamstring injury.

Phoenix Suns open the 2025-26 season without high expectations after having championship aspirations the previous four seasons.
Phoenix Suns owner Mat Ishbia is driving a cultural reset under new coach Jordan Ott, with players such as Collin Gillespie embracing the new identity. The Suns aim to combine strong leadership, accountability and player development to redefine the franchise on and off the court.
Phoenix isn’t even projected to make the play-in tournament, let alone the playoffs, but it sees this season as a foundation in building up to once again contending for an NBA title.Start the day smarter.
